TEE UP

Originally created by the legendary John R. Van Kleek, a well-known golf course and landscape architect, the championship Vinoy Golf Course was redesigned by Ron Garl, who believes that a course should, “. . . sit softly on the land.”

The Vinoy’s beautifully manicured and scenic greens, a testament to his success, are home to a colorful variety of birds and wildlife. As stimulating to play as it is enjoyable to view, the 18-hole, par-71 course challenges serious golfers while providing an enjoyable round for casual players. A driving range, practice putting green, bunker and chipping area help you hone your game.

A certified Audubon Cooperative Sanctuary, the course is a refuge for wildlife. Each hole is surrounded by diverse vegetation, including Live Oaks, pines and more than a dozen varieties of palms from around the world, such as Bismarck palms (Bismarckia nobilis), found in Madagascar, and Giant Fishtail palms (Caryota no) from Indonesia.

The course is located on picturesque Snell Isle, just minutes from the resort via complimentary transportation. Its clubhouse is another historic treasure, an ornate collection of Spanish and Moorish Renaissance influences that was once a section of a European palace and was brought to St. Petersburg in 1925 by local developer Perry Snell. Designed as a replica of a mosque and open-air market, it features minarets, heavily bracketed cornices, horseshoe and keyhole arches and onion domes.

THE ORANGE TEES

The Vinoy Golf Course introduced the Orange tees, designed for beginner, junior and super senior players. The course length is just over 3,082 yards and covers the normal 18 holes. The next shortest length set of tees is over 4,925 yards.

For those drawn by the irresistible pull of the water and the desire to travel by current, not causeway, The Vinoy’s full-service marina offers new horizons and adventures. Just steps from the resort, it features 74 fixed concrete slips and can accommodate vessels up to 130 feet length overall. Guests can sail or motor in, then stay onboard while enjoying all The Vinoy’s amenities, including room service.

If you left your yacht at home, a licensed captain from the Sailing Florida Charters & Sailing School can navigate your course aboard one of their Hunter yachts. Skim along the water while sighting dolphins, pelicans and St. Petersburg’s skyline.

Relax as a passenger or help hoist the sails as an apprentice sailor. Half-day cruises, sunset cruises and ASA (American Sailing Association) sailing school packages are available.

HEAD COURTSIDE

Each game, set or match is a memorable experience for tennis enthusiasts at The Vinoy. The Tennis Club’s 12 championship HarTru® green clay surface courts are complemented by lush, tropical surroundings and lit for shadowfree night play. Daily morning or evening clinics are geared to all levels and tailored to those who sign up.

Find the latest equipment and the finest names in tennis fashions at the pro shop, where helpful staff will also match you up with a suitable partner. Private or group lessons are available, as well.
